Spaghetti with shrimp

Ingredients for 3 servings:

  • 250 g shrimp(s), marinated (herbs de Provence and garlic, frozen)
  • 500g spaghetti
  • 1 beefsteak tomato(s)
  • 3 cloves garlic
  • ½ bunch parsley, flat
  • 1 pinch of chili powder
  • 5 tbsp olive oil
  • e.g. salt and pepper
  • e.g. Parmesan (if desired)

Instructions

Working time approx. 15 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 8 minutes; Total time approx. 23 minutes

Thaw the marinated shrimp. Remove the seeds from the tomatoes and chop them finely, dice the garlic, and chop the parsley. Cook the pasta according to the package instructions until al dente. Sauté the marinated shrimp in a little oil. Add the tomatoes, garlic, and parsley and sauté briefly. Season with chili powder, salt, and pepper. Finally, add the remaining oil, heat briefly, and toss with the spaghetti. If desired, serve with a sprinkle of Parmesan cheese.
